AI-assisted phishing simulation analytics

The click isn’t the lesson.
The trigger it exploited is.

A dashboard that reads phishing simulation results and breaks them down by scenario category and employee department, so security and L&D teams can see exactly where risk concentrates and assign follow-up training that's actually targeted, not just repeated.
